Transaction 8758a437242d0f043893641409f566695a8f164c13cc874fb9aa969900139000

1 Input
2 Outputs
  • 8758a437242d0f043893641409f566695a8f164c13cc874fb9aa969900139000:0
  • value  186172
    address  1JSk52oKt7Szh94UQCztWzttFP3SnGU5Xp
  • 8758a437242d0f043893641409f566695a8f164c13cc874fb9aa969900139000:1
  • value  1645651
    address  3D6HBSP1ThhuZYrWvLG2iffw24Pnr6AmmV